OPERATING INSTRUCTIONS 

The SENTINEL night vision riflescope is intended for observation and shooting at dusk or during 
nighttime hours. It is a passive starlight device, and in most conditions does not require an artificial 
or IR light source. The scope is built with a high performance Gen1 image intensifier tube. The 
built-in IR illuminator enhances a viewing ability in environments of absolute darkness. Power 
supply, with the voltage stabilization, works up to 70 hours using 2 AA batteries. Low batteries do 
not affect aiming ability. Additional remote stabilized power supply was designed for optimized 
power consumption, which ensures a consistent aiming point in conditions of continuous power 
draw or drop in temperature. 
The SENTINEL is a universal night vision scope, which is ideal for night observation and hunting. 
 

USING THE SENTINEL 

The SENTINEL was designed to provide many years of reliable service. To ensure longevity and 
performance, it is necessary to follow all procedures and guidelines outlined in this manual.  
 

Warning:  

The SENTINEL is not recommended for use with cartridges producing recoil rating higher than 
3700 joules or calibers in excess of 7.62/.300. The manufacturer's warranty will be voided if damage 
is caused by caliber cartridges greater than 7.62/.300, hand made cartridges or shooting from a 
smooth-bore barrel.    
 

 

Do not remove the lens cap in a lit area if the scope has been activated or if the eyepiece is 
emitting a green glow.  

 

Exposure to bright light can damage the image intensifier tube (IIT).  

 

Do not remove the objective lens cover in a lit area immediately after using the scope. It will 
stay activated for 20 minutes after the unit has been turned off.     

 

The scope has an IPX4 water resistance rating. It is water resistant and can be used in 
inclement weather conditions. 

 

Do not attempt to repair or disassemble the scope!  

 

Clean the scope's optical surfaces only if necessary, and use caution. Remove dust and sand 
by blowing air across the optic surface, then apply lens cleaning fluid for multi layered optics 
onto a soft cloth or tissue and wipe carefully. Do not pour any fluid, including alcohol, onto 
the lenses directly.  

 

The scope can be used in temperatures ranging from -30°

С

 to +40°

С

. However, when it is 

brought indoors from cold temperatures, wait 3-4 hours before using the unit.  

 

Consult a qualified gunsmith if there is difficulty attaching the scope firmly to a rifle or if 
there is uncertainty about the right type of mount. The weapon mount can be deformed or 
destroyed by shooting with a riflescope that is not mounted correctly.
